Modulating the microbiota of the hospital environment by probiotic cleaning: impact on infections and antimicrobial resistance

ELISABETTA CASELLI Targeting Microbiota 2019 v1During the 7th World Congress on Targeting Microbiota scheduled on October 10-11, 2019 at the ParkInn Hotel - Krakow, Poland, the Scientific commitee will dedicate a full session related to the Built Environment Microbiome.

Dr. Elisabetta Caselli from the University of Ferrara, Italy will give a presentation entitled "Modulating the microbiota of the hospital environment by probiotic cleaning: impact on infections and antimicrobial resistance".

Dr. Caselli summarizes: "Healthcare–associated infections (HAIs) are a global concern, whose major causes include the persistent microbial contamination of the hospital environment, and the growing antimicrobial-resistance (AMR) of HAI-associated microbes.

The control of contamination has been so far addressed by the use of chemical-based sanitation procedures, which however do not prevent recontamination and can select resistant microbes.

By contrast, a microbial-based sanitation system, inspired by the microbiome balance principles, was shown to induce remodulation of hospital microbiota, obtaining a stable control of bioburden and AMR, associated to a significant reduction of HAIs."

International Space Station and hospital environments: Composition and function of microbiomes in confined built environments

Christine Moissl Eichinger Targeting Microbiota 2019
During the 7th World Congress on Targeting Microbiota scheduled on October 10-11, 2019 at the Park Inn Hotel - Krakow, Poland, the Scientific commitee will dedicate a full session related to the Built Environment Microbiome.
Prof. Christine Moissl-Eichinger from Medical University Graz, Austria will present the research work entitled "International Space Station and hospital environments: Composition and function of microbiomes in confined built environments".
 
Prof. Moissl-Eichinger highlights: "Indoor environments, where people spend most of their time, are characterized by a specific microbial community, the indoor microbiome. Most indoor environments are connected to the natural environment, but some habitats are more confined: intensive care units, operating rooms, cleanrooms and the international space station (ISS) are extraordinary living and working areas for humans, with a limited exchange with the environment. All of these man-made confined habitats are microbiologically monitored and controlled. However, these measures might apply constant selective pressures, which support microbes with resistance capacities against chemical and physical stresses and thus might facilitate the rise of survival specialists and multi-resistant strains. In this talk, special characteristics of confined indoor microbiomes will be highlighted, and their specific functions and the consequences thereof will be discussed."

Hyaluronan, a new neuroimmune modulator of the microbiota-immune-gut-axis

Cristina Giaron Targeting Microbiota 2019 updDr. Cristina Giaroni from University of Insubria, Italy will give presentation entitled "Hyaluronan, a new neuroimmune modulator of the microbiota-immune-gut-axis".

Summary of talk: "The gut saprophytic commensal flora has a fundamental role in the modulation of several local functions including regulation of host immune system and defense against pathogenic microorganisms. Alterations in the symbiotic relationship between the microbiota and the enteric microenvironment underlays development of complex gut disorders such as chronic inflammatory disease (IBD). In recent years, we have focused on hyluronan (HA), an unbranched glycosaminoglycan (GAG) component of the extracellular matrix, as a new molecular player involved in neuroadaptive changes of enteric neuronal circuitries in the inflamed gut. The GAG is a key molecule mediating the host immune response to commensal and pathogenic bacteria by binding to toll-like receptors, TLR2 and 4. Since both TLRs have been localized to enteric neurons and may regulate intestinal inflammation by controlling enteric nervous system (ENS) structural and functional integrity, HA represents a potential molecular tool involved in development of myenteric neural plasticity by tuning adaptive signals at the intersection between the microbiota-innate immunity axis and ENS. This hypothesis is innovative and opens new scenarios in the study of the molecular mechanism involved in the onset and severity of bowel diseases as well as for the development of new therapeutic agents for the treatment of diseases with clinical and social impact, all with underlying derangements of the microbiota-immune-gut axis, such as IBD."

Gut microbiota and graft-versus-host disease in patients after bone marrow transplantation. FMT as a prevention or treatment?

Jarosław Bilinski Targeting Microbiota 2019

Dr. Jaroslaw Bilinski from Department of Hematology, Oncology and Internal Diseases, Medical University of Warsaw, Poland will join the 7th World Congress of Targeting Microbiota which will be held in Krakow, Poland on October 10-11, 2019.
 
During the meeting Dr. Bilinski will give a presentation entitled "Gut microbiota and graft-versus-host disease in patients after bone marrow transplantation. FMT as a prevention or treatment?".
 
Gut dysbiosis is considered as trigger or cause of many diseases including graft-versus-host disease (GvHD), a life threatening complication that occurs after allogeneic hematopoietic cell transplantation (alloHCT) caused by an allogeneic attack of donor T cells against recipient tissues. Gut GvHD is the most difficult to treat and linked with high mortality. There are novel insights to immune system interplaying with microbiota which we may use and try to modulate microbiota to prevent or treat GvHD. The question is when and what to do, as the process of immune stimulation is very fluent.

Metabolic and Metagenomic Consequences of E. coli Infections

Matteo SERINO Targeting Microbiota 2019The Scientific Committee of Targeting Microbiota 2019 Congress invited Dr. Matteo Serino from Inserm and Digestive Health Research Institute, France.

Dr. Serino will give a presentation entitled "Metabolic and Metagenomic Consequences of E. coli Infections".

Summary of Presentation: A dietary fat enrichment is among the strongest factors impacting on gut microbiota on a both structural and functional level, as well known as inducer of metabolic diseases such as obesity, type 2 diabetes and hepatopathology. Interestingly, an alimentary switch towards the high-fat content has been also shown  capable of favouring the colonisation of the intestine by enterobacteria. Among the latters are pro-inflammatory and/or genotoxic E. coli strains. The metabolic consequences of the infections by these bacteria in mice will be discussed in relation to a lean vs. an obese/diabetic host, together with changes in the gut microbiota and microbiome.

Risk for Diabetes and Cardiovascular diseases in the Qatari population: can the salivary microbiome predict it?

Souhaila Al Khodor Targeting Microbiota 2019Dr. Souhaila Al Khodor from Sidra Medical and Research Center, Qatar will join the 7th World Congress on Targeting Microbiota and speak about "Risk for Diabetes and Cardiovascular diseases in the Qatari population: can the salivary microbiome predict it?" during the Targeting Microbiota 2019 Congress which will be held in Park Inn Hotel - Krakow, Poland, on October 10 - 11, 2019.

Dr. Al Khodor highligthed: "During the Congress I will discuss whether the salivary microbiome composition can predict whether individuals are predisposed to cardiovascular disease or diabetes."

Cardiovascular diseases (CVD) and diabetes are estimated to account for 69% of death in Qatar. Since saliva is an easily accessible sample, not invasive,  it is usually easy to collect from subjects, hence, we plan to assess whether salivary microbiome can be used as a tool to predict those diseases.

Dr. Al Khodor and her team will calculate the CVD score and record the diabetes status (prediabetic, diabetic or non-diabetic) of the study subjects. Then assess the salivary microbiome composition using 16S rRNA gene sequencing and correlate the microbiome data with the phenotypic and clinical data.

Exploring the role of gut dysbiosis in neuroinflammation and hypertension

Dave Durgan Microbiota 2018 updProf. David Durgan from  Baylor College of Medicine, USA will give a strategic presentation during the 6th World Congress on Targeting Microbiota 2018 about "Exploring the role of gut dysbiosis in neuroinflammation and hypertension" during the congress.

According to Prof. Durgan: "Hypertension is one of the most prevalent risk factors for the development of cardiovascular disease. We have demonstrated that multiple models of hypertension exhibit gut dysbiosis, and that dysbiosis plays a causal role in the development of hypertension. We have found that this involves neuroinflammation, and are currently examining a potential microbiota-gut-brain axis involved in blood pressure regulation. Our studies demonstrate that treatments to prevent or reverse gut dysbiosis may be valuable in the treatment of hypertension."

Role of microbes in stem cells transplantation related complication

Pr Ernst Holler Microbiota 2018 Speaker

Prof. Ernst Holler from University Hospital Regensburg, Germany will join the 6th World Congress on Targeting Microbiota 2018 and will talk about "Role of microbes in stem cells transplantation related complication" during the congress.

Summary of presentation: "Haematopoietic stem cell transplantation is a curative treatment optionin patients with leukemia but can be complicated by life threatenningGraft-versus-Host Disease (GvHD) especially in the gastrointestinal (GI)tract. In the last 5 years, early and severe disruption of theintestinal microbiota has been identified as a major risk factor ofGI-GvHD.  Broad spectrum antibiotics applied for neutropenic infectionsbut also destruction of Paneth cells by GvHD itself are major factorsresulting in dysbiosis which strongly enhances intestinal inflammationinduced by donor cells. Lack of protective metabolites such as shortchain fatty acids and indoles produced by commensal explains thisassociation but direct microbiota – T cell interactions maycontribute. Restoration of a protective microbiome may become analternative approach for treatment and prevention of GI-GvHD."
